Expired vehicle tag found during traffic stop, Daytona Beach Shores FL
Heads up: This post was detected from real-time dispatch audio. Information may be incomplete, and the situation may evolve. Always verify using official agency releases.
According to the dispatch call, a traffic stop was made on a white Jeep near South Atlantic Avenue. The vehicle's tag was found to be expired since March 2017 and is not assigned to the vehicle. Further verification and possible follow-up are underway.
